Spring cleaning time. Have had this thing sitting in my barn for 10 years and have not done anything with it so it is now time to go .

I have an old Wheel Horse either a D180 or D200 - not sure as hood decal differs from the cowling decal. The tractor is complete but I do not have the engine. Anyway the tractor has 3 point hitch, rear PTO, and Hydrostat drive. I also have the belly 48" mower deck and a heavy duty front dozer blade attachment (this blade is much heavier than traditional snow plow type blade).

Anybody have any idea what would be a fair starting price to ask so I can list on Craigslist? (either as a parts machine or as a fixer upper if someone has an engine).

The D series were very nice tractors, I had one years ago, it was a D 250 and it had a 4 cylinder Opel gas engine in it.

One just can't compare the " D " series WH with anything else in the WH line. Weight is around 1,000 lbs and that might be w/out the deck. The automatic just spoils you to the point where you refuse to get anything other than a hydro. The WH auto is so smooth and powerful its almost hard to believe. I paid $ 400 for a snow/dozer blade that has run into standing trees at speed and has not bent in the slightest. The A frame for the blade goes well over 100 lbs as well as the blade.
These are super machines, only weak point seems to be the lack of automatic repair parts. The rest can be had or made. A " real " JD Deere for about $ 6,000 or more would be a comparable machine.
